14.4 Modbus Addresses
There are 4 types of Modbus addresses:
0x Read/Write Digital outputs – off/on commands
These are binary values and have a 0/1
value indicating an off/on or no/yes value.
1x Read Digital inputs – off/on signals/indications
3x Read Analogue inputs – variable data in
These are multiple integer values and can
have a value of 0 to 65534 and do not
contain decimal points i.e. channel 1
position Modbus value is 900 which is
equivalent to 90.0°.
4x Read/Write Analogue outputs – variable adjustments
